A Stereocontrolled Approach to the Oxa-Bridged Octalin System of Coloradocin (Luminamicin)

The 5-methylene-1,2,3,4,4a,5,8,8a-octahydronaphthalen-2-ol 17 undergoes intramolecular cyclization to provide an entry into the 11-oxatricyclo[5.3.1.03,8]undec-5-ene system of coloradocin (1).
